What is PwC Indoor Geolocation Platform?

Connected Solutions offers a groundbreaking methodology for indoor geolocation through its patented Indoor Geolocation Platform, a product from PwC, which differentiates itself from conventional IoT systems by removing the necessity for any in-room infrastructure. This state-of-the-art solution eliminates the need for beacons that require maintenance, hinder design aesthetics, or introduce security risks, allowing users to deploy an IoT geolocation system in just days rather than the typical months. The innovation stems from IGP’s capability to leverage existing signals like WiFi and Bluetooth, using these to create a unique fingerprint for every room or prominent area in your building. This leap forward enables businesses to surpass the outdated dependence on WiFi hotspots, cellular networks, and cumbersome beacon configurations, thus allowing for a more concentrated effort on improving customer experiences. Furthermore, the platform guarantees compliance by proficiently monitoring the locations of essential assets, particularly employees, who can easily request help with a straightforward button press. By adopting IGP, organizations can enhance their operational efficiency while ensuring the safety and effectiveness of their workforce. This transformation not only optimizes logistical operations but also fosters a more responsive environment for both staff and customers alike.
